Question Young Coconuts & Durian

Both are prominently featured in my eating and, sadly, neither are available as organic.
Have been unable to find any info on how much of an issue this is. Did hear that the young coconuts are soaked in formaldehyde before export to preserve the white husk exterior. True or not and how does this affect the meat and water within?

I have heard that young coconuts are soaked in formaldehyde. They do have a thick skin, so I do not know how much of an issue this would be in terms of contaminating the insides. I know that the rule with nonorganic produce is that the thicker the skin, the less contaminated the insides are. For example, avocados, oranges and bananas are less exposed to multiple pesticides than are raspberries, strawberries and apples. If you find any research, I would be interested to find out!

The Truth About Thai Coconuts and Formaldehyde.

Are you one of those whose initial excitement in discovering Thai Coconuts was quickly replaced with fear when you heard the rumor that the sweet treat is soaked in formaldehyde before reaching the United States?

I don ??t know where it started nor can I remember when I first heard it but the rumor is certainly wide-spread.

I have had dozens of friends and clients ask me about it in panicked phone calls or during my raw food preparation classes or visits to our caf ?.

Some fearful raw-fooders have completely removed Thai Coconuts from their diets in response to the rumor and there are even raw restaurants that have deleted them from their menus.

In short, we have all allowed this rumor to spread based completely on hearsay and without any definitive proof.

My wife Janabai and I love Thai Coconuts and weren ??t willing to leave them out of our morning shakes or delete them from our caf ? ??s menu until we received definitive proof that they are in fact, treated with formaldehyde.

Waiting for someone else to provide such proof was getting us nowhere. We decided to find the truth, not only for ourselves but also for our customers and for those spreading fear by way of a baseless rumor.

We contacted Michelson Laboratories. Michelson is a fully accredited microbiology and chemical testing lab with over 70 highly trained specialists and technicians located in Commerce, California.

Michelson was confident that after proper testing of a sample they could tell us definitively whether or not Thai Coconuts were treated with formaldehyde.

We supplied Michelson with a sample from our regular stock of Thai Coconuts and waited patiently as the testing process began.

As the weeks went on, Janabai and I decided that whatever the result, we would disseminate the information as widely as possible. We would either discontinue our use of Thai Coconuts and warn others or dispel the myth and continue to promote Thai Coconuts.

On Thursday, May 11th we received the results from the lab.

There was absolutely no indication whatsoever that the Thai Coconut sample provided to Michelson Laboratories was ever in contact with formaldehyde.

We were excited. Not just because we could continue to enjoy Thai Coconuts but also because definitive proof had finally been obtained.

A copy of the lab findings will be available at Euphoria Loves RAWvolution at 2301 Main Street in Santa Monica.

It is my hope that in the future, our raw food communities will not fall prey to lies and made-up stories. These rumors divide rather than unite and spread fear rather than information.
